Emerson McAlister

Hi there! My name is Emerson. I'm a 26 year old transgender man that has been singing since I was 10. I originally trained and performed as a soprano, receiving a BFA from Carnegie Mellon University and an MM from San Francisco Conservatory of Music in Vocal Performance. I've performed in Germany, Austria, and all over the Bay Area. My past roles include Countess Almaviva in Le nozze di Figaro, Governess in The Turn of the Screw, Zweite Dame in Die Zauberflöte, etc. Now, as a man, I've begun to sing roles like Papageno in Die Zaberflöte and Leporello in Don Giovanni. However, I perform mostly musical theater these days. My roles have included Utterson in Jekyll and Hyde, Bert Healey in Annie, and Cliff in Cabaret. I specialize in transgender voices/students and love to help them along their voice journey.
